How necessary are grips for the vita? I was listening to the Oddworld episode of Watch Out for Fireballs abs they mentioned it was a little difficult with out the L2 and R2 buttons, so I was wondering what you goons think of its worth getting?

Vita games mostly don't use the rear touchpad, and those that do have specific rear touchpad controls (instead of just mapping virtual buttons to areas of the touchpad), so this is only a concern if you're playing a lot of PSX games.

The L2/R2 grip is essentiually just a couple of rubber bits that hit the rear touchpad when you press the physical L2/R2 buttons, so it's entirely possible to play without one. I find it much more comfortable than playing the Vita without the grip regardless of whether or not I'm playing something that uses the L2/R2 "buttons," but I have big hands.

It's still Japan-exclusive and something you have to import at a high premium if you want those two extra buttons, though. Most Vita grips are just a plastic shell that makes it more comfortable to hold.

So Vita Mem cards are about as plentiful as fountains of youth near me. Do you need a mem card or does the Vita have a built in hard drive, like even just for saves of games from a disk?

You need a memory card. There's no on-board memory and cartridges can't hold data.
